Abstract

The utility model discloses a projection device for classroom blackboard writing teaching, which comprises a mounting plate and a protective shell positioned on the lower side of the mounting plate, wherein a plurality of sliding grooves are formed in the mounting plate and the protective shell, a damping mechanism is arranged between each pair of sliding grooves, a plurality of limiting grooves are formed in the mounting plate and the protective shell, a fixing plate is arranged in the protective shell, two electric telescopic rods are fixedly connected to the protective shell, the output ends of the two electric telescopic rods are fixedly connected with the fixing plate together, a projector is arranged on the fixing plate, and telescopic mechanisms are arranged between the two ends of the fixing plate and the protective shell. The projector can be prevented from being damaged due to external force collision by arranging the protective shell and the damping mechanism; can accomodate the projecting apparatus when not using through telescopic machanism, avoid dust adhesion to influence the use.

Technical Field
The utility model relates to the technical field of projection devices, in particular to a projection device for classroom blackboard writing teaching.
Background
The projector is also called a projector, is a device capable of projecting images or videos onto a curtain, can be connected with a computer, a VCD, a DVD, a BD, a game machine, a DV and the like through different interfaces to play corresponding video signals, and needs to use a projection device in classroom blackboard writing teaching.
The existing projector is installed on the top of a wall, and when the existing projector is collided by external force, the projector is damaged; the existing projector is exposed outside for a long time, dust is attached to the projector to influence the use of the projector, and therefore the projector device for classroom blackboard writing teaching is designed to solve the problems.

Detailed Description
The technical solution in the embodiments of the present invention will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present invention.
Referring to fig. 1-6, a projection device for classroom blackboard writing teaching comprises a mounting plate 1 and a protective casing 2 positioned at the lower side of the mounting plate 1, wherein four threaded holes are arranged on the mounting plate 1 in a penetrating way, the device can be fixed by matching bolts with threaded holes, a plurality of sliding grooves 3 are arranged on the mounting plate 1 and the protective shell 2, a shock absorption mechanism is arranged between each pair of sliding grooves 3, the shock absorption mechanism comprises sliding blocks 4 which are positioned in the two sliding grooves 3 and are in sliding connection with the sliding grooves, the two sliding blocks 4 are fixedly connected with a connecting rod 5 together, a plurality of buffer springs 6 are fixedly connected between the two sliding blocks 4 and the corresponding sliding grooves 3 respectively, fixed blocks 8 are fixedly connected at both ends of the two sliding blocks 4, and the four fixed blocks 8 are in sliding connection with the inner walls of the corresponding limiting grooves 7 respectively, the projector 11 can be prevented from being damaged by external collision by providing the protective case 2 and the shock-absorbing mechanism.

The telescopic mechanism comprises a rack plate 12 fixedly connected with a fixed plate 10, a plurality of rack teeth matched with a gear 15 are arranged on the rack plate 12, two fixing frames 13 are fixedly connected with the inner wall of a protective shell 2, a rotary rod 14 is jointly and rotatably connected between the two fixing frames 13, the gear 15 is fixedly connected with the rotary rod 14, the gear 15 is meshed with the rack plate 12, a driving wheel 16 is fixedly connected with the rotary rod 14, two connecting blocks 19 are fixedly connected with the inner wall of the protective shell 2, the connecting blocks 19 are fixedly connected with the protective shell 2 through welding, a rotary rod 20 is jointly and rotatably connected between the two connecting blocks 19, a driven wheel 18 is fixedly connected with the rotary rod 20, a conveying belt 17 is sleeved on the outer walls of the driving wheel 16 and the driven wheel 18, a sealing door 21 is fixedly connected with the rotary rod 20, the sealing door 21 can be driven to rotate and open through the downward movement of a projector 11, and the sealing door 21 can be driven to rotate and close through the upward movement of the projector 11, the projector 11 is protected from being housed.
In the utility model, a worker firstly starts the electric telescopic rod 9, the output end of the electric telescopic rod 9 drives the fixing plate 10 and the projector 11 to move downwards, and the rack plate 12 is driven to move downwards in the downward movement process of the fixing plate 10, so that the gear 15, the rotating rod 14, the driving wheel 16, the conveying belt 17, the driven wheel 18, the rotating rod 20 and the sealing door 21 rotate, that is, the protective shell 2 can be opened, and the projector 11 can extend out conveniently; the electric telescopic rod 9 drives the fixing plate 10 and the projector 11 to move upwards, so that the sealing door 21 can be horizontally arranged, the protective shell 2 is sealed, and the dust is prevented from falling onto the projector 11 to influence the function of the projector 11 through the sealing arrangement of the protective shell 2; when receiving external force and making protecting sheathing 2 take place vibrations, make slider 4 slide in sliding tray 3, make buffer spring 6 compression or tensile, can cushion protection protecting sheathing 2 through buffer spring 6's deformation, avoid 11 internals of projecting apparatus in the protecting sheathing 2 to damage because of vibrations, extension means's life.
